Types of Metal Clips: A Comprehensive Catalogue

The world of metal clips is vast and varied, offering a solution for every organizational need:

  • Paper clips: The classic metal clip, perfect for binding a few sheets of paper together.

  • Binder clips: Larger and more powerful, binder clips can hold a substantial amount of paper securely.

  • Bulldog clips: These heavy-duty clips are ideal for clamping down on thick stacks of documents or securing cords.

  • Chip clips: Designed to keep food bags and other items sealed, chip clips are a kitchen staple.

Comparing Pros and Cons: An Informed Decision

To help you make an informed decision about which metal clips to use, here's a table comparing their advantages and disadvantages:

Clip Type Pros Cons
Paper clip Lightweight, affordable, easy to use Limited holding capacity
Binder clip Strong, versatile, reusable Can be bulky
Bulldog clip Heavy-duty, durable Can be difficult to open
Chip clip Compact, convenient, food-safe Not suitable for heavy-duty tasks
Lobster claw Extremely strong, weather-resistant Expensive, large size
